Jak korzystać z czujników lm?

65

Chciałem zainstalować pakiet do monitorowania temperatury mojego procesora zwany lm-sensoramiZainstaluj czujniki lm .

Według Synaptic jest już zainstalowany.

Czy ktoś może podać mi proste instrukcje krok po kroku, w jaki sposób mogę go uruchomić z wiersza poleceń lub w inny sposób?

sq1020
źródło

Odpowiedzi:

73

Po lm-sensorszainstalowaniu musisz sięgnąć po swój terminal:

rodzaj

sudo sensors-detect

wystarczy nacisnąć ENTER, aby wyświetlić wszystko, co sugeruje (pokazane wielkimi literami)

Na koniec zapyta Cię, czy dodać to, co znajdzie /etc/modules. Jeśli jesteś zadowolony z wyników, wpisz „tak”.

Więcej informacji o czujnikach lm i sposobach dostosowania go do systemu można znaleźć na stronie wiki instalacji czujników lm

Pisanie na maszynie

sensors

wyświetli wartości wykrytych wcześniej czujników.

na przykład

acpitz-virtual-0
Adapter: Virtual device
temp1:       +55.0°C  (crit = +90.0°C)
fossfreedom
źródło
5
+1 za sensors-detect, dostałem od niego dwa dodatkowe sensory :)
Lekensteyn,
29
Wskazówka: użyj watchpolecenia, aby zobaczyć aktualizacje danych wyjściowych sensorspolecenia w czasie rzeczywistym! Tak jak:$ watch sensors
oaskamay
NIE używaj sensors-detect! Może trwale uszkodzić Twój sprzęt! phoronix.com/scan.php?page=news_item&px=MTQ3MDE
stommestack
5
@JopV. - musisz uważniej przeczytać artykuł - programiści poprosili dystrybutorów dystrybucji o backport stabilnej wersji. Tak właśnie zrobił ubuntu. changelogs.ubuntu.com/changelogs/pool/main/l/lm-sensors/…
fossfreedom
2
Musiałem uruchomić sudo, ponownie uruchomić kmod, aby zobaczyć wyniki po wykryciu czujników
Ali Cheaito
27

czujniki lm Zainstaluj czujniki lm

to zestaw narzędzi do sterowania i przeglądania czujników, które mogą znajdować się na twoim sprzęcie. Uwzględniono kilka aplikacji uruchamianych z wiersza polecenia:

  • czujniki : pokazuje aktualne odczyty wszystkich układów czujników.
  • sensord : demon do okresowego rejestrowania odczytów czujnika do syslog
  • fancontrol : oblicza prędkości wentylatora na podstawie temperatur i ustawia odpowiednie wyjścia PWM
  • pwmconfig : testuje wyjścia PWM czujników i konfiguruje fancontrol
  • i więcej (szczegóły w dokumentacji czujników lm )

Aby uruchomić te programy, otwórz terminal i wpisz nazwę aplikacji (w tym parametry opcjonalne, zobacz strony podręcznika, aby uzyskać szczegółowe informacje). To da wynik podobny do pokazanego tutaj dla czujników :

~$ sensors

k8temp-pci-00c3
Adapter: PCI adapter
Core0 Temp:  +30.0°C                                    
Core0 Temp:  +30.0°C                                    
Core1 Temp:  +29.0°C                                    
Core1 Temp:  +36.0°C                                    

it8718-isa-0228
Adapter: ISA adapter
[...] # shortened

Konfiguracja lm czujników odbywa się poprzez pliki konfiguracyjne w /etc/sensors3.confi w /etc/sensors.conf(szczegóły patrz manpage dla sensors.conf ).

Takkat
źródło
4
+1 za wprowadzenie mnie do poleceń nie wiedziałem o (fancontrol, pwmconfig)
jwernerny
@jwernerny: jest jeszcze więcej :)
Takkat,
Dzięki. Ale nie widzę sensordw Ubuntu bionic 18.04. Czy istnieje inny sposób rejestrowania odczytów?
nealmcb
16

psensor Zainstaluj psensor

Bardzo lubię psensor ... działa on na pasku wskaźników („Systray” obok zegara), więc jest to być może najbardziej dyskretna aplikacja, z której korzysta lm-sensors. Może również wyświetlać ładne okno z wykresami wyświetlającymi historię każdego czujnika, podobnie jak Monitor Systemu dla pamięci, użycia procesora itp. Ma również rejestrację!

Wykorzystuje także czujniki inne niż lm-sensors, takie jak hddtemptemperatura dysków twardych oraz temperatura i wentylator NVidia i AMD GPU (karty graficzne).

wprowadź opis zdjęcia tutaj

Lepsze zrzuty ekranu niż moje można znaleźć na stronie autora:

http://wpitchoune.net/blog/psensor/

MestreLion
źródło
13

czujniki Zainstaluj xsensory

Ma łatwy do zrozumienia interfejs graficzny. Pokazuje mi napięcia płyty głównej (są ich cztery), temperaturę procesora i płyty głównej, a także prędkość wentylatora procesora, prędkość trzech wentylatorów obudowy i prędkość wentylatora mocy. Wszystko monitorowane w czasie rzeczywistym. I ładuje się do Unity Dash.

wprowadź opis zdjęcia tutaj

grahammechanical
źródło